Fried Beef with Onion and Cumin

1. Cut beef into small pieces.

2. Put oyster sauce, dark soy sauce, cornstarch, cooking wine, sugar and cumin powder, pinch evenly with your hands, and marinate for 2 hours.

3. Heat the pan, add 1 tablespoon of oil, and stir-fry the beef over high heat.

4. Stir-fry for about 2-3 minutes to 8 minutes.

5. Fry the onion in another oil pan until soft.

6. My family likes fully cooked onions.

7. Pour in the fried beef and stir-fry well.

8. Just sprinkle with chopped green onion.
